Introduction & Overview to ENT Doctors and Otolaryngology Specialists

Otolaryngology is the oldest medical specialty in the United States and represents a branch of medicine that specializes in the diagnose and treatment of conditions and disorders of the ear, nose, and throat, and disorders of the head and neck. The full name of the specialty is otolaryngology-head and neck surgery, while their practitioners are called otolaryngologists-head and neck surgeons, otorhinolaryngologists (ORL), or more common ENT specialists or physicians (ear, nose, throat).

ENT specialists are physicians trained in the medical and surgical management and treatment of patients suffering from conditions or disorders of the ear, nose, throat, sinuses, larynx (voice box), oral cavity and upper pharynx, as well as related structures of head and neck. An ENT specialist’s expertise covers a wide range of problems.

Problems, conditions, disorders and diseases treated by ENT specialists:
1. Ear

  • Hearing loss.
  • Ear ache.
  • Mastoiditis (infection of the mastoid process).
  • Otitis externa (ear canal inflammation).
  • Otitis media (middle ear inflmamation).
  • Otitis interna (inner ear inflammation).
  • Tinnitus (ear noised).
  • Dizziness and balance disorders (such as benign paroxysmal positional vertigo - BPPV, labyrinthitis, and vestibular neuronitis).
  • Perforated eardrum (due to infection, trauma, explosion, or loud noise).

2. Nose

  • Allergies.
  • Sinusitis (acute and chronic).
  • Rhinitis (irritation and inflammation of some internal areas of the nose)..
  • Empty nose syndrome (a nose crippled by over resection of the middle or inferior turbinates of the nose).
  • Deviated septum
  • Dysphonia

3. Throat

  • Tonsillitis (an infectionof the tonsil).
  • Laryngitis
  • Vocal cord paralysis
  • Vocal nodules, polyps and cysts
  • Dysphagia/Swallowing conditions
  • Gastroesophageal or laryngopharyngeal reflux disease
  • Esophageal conditions
  • Throat cancer
  • Laryngeal cancer
  • Voice conditions
  • Breathing conditions

Surgical procedures performed by ENT specialists:

  • Rhinoplasty (surgical procedure performed to improved the function and/or appearance of the nose).
  • Septoplasty (corrective surgical procedure performed to straighten the nasal septum).
  • Adenoidectomy (surgical procedure performed to remove the adenoids).
  • Tracheotomy, also known as tracheostomy (surgical procedure performed on the neck to create an airway opening in the trachea).
  • Myringotomy (surgical procedure performed to create a tiny incision in the eardrum to relieve the pressure caused by accumulation of excessive fluid or pus).
  • Rhytidectomy (facial lift).
  • Blepharoplasty (functional and corrective surgical procedure performed to reshape the upper or lower eyelid).
  • Browplasty, also knows as forehead lift or browlift (cosmetic surgical procedure performed to elevate the eyelid).
  • Otoplasty (corrective cosmetic surgical procedure performed to change the appearance of the external ears).
  • Genioplasty or mentoplasty (cosmetic procedure performed to change the appearance of the chin).
